ADA4899-1YRDZ Tech Specifications
Analog Devices Inc. ADA4899-1YRDZ technical specifications, attributes, parameters and parts with similar specifications to Silicon Labs SI1084-A-GM.
Product Attribute | Attribute Value | |
---|---|---|
Category | Linear - Amplifiers - Instrumentation, OP Amps, Buffer Amps | |

Lifecycle Status | PRODUCTION (Last Updated: 1 month ago) | |
Factory Lead Time | 10 Weeks | |
Contact Plating | Tin | |
Mounting Type | Surface Mount | |
Package / Case | 8-SOIC (0.154, 3.90mm Width) Exposed Pad | |
Surface Mount | YES | |
Number of Pins | 8Pins | |
Operating Temperature | -40°C~125°C | |
Packaging | Tube | |
JESD-609 Code | e3 | |
Pbfree Code | no | |
Part Status | Active | |
Moisture Sensitivity Level (MSL) | 3 (168 Hours) | |
Number of Terminations | 8Terminations | |
ECCN Code | EAR99 | |
Terminal Position | DUAL | |
Terminal Form | GULL WING | |
Number of Functions | 1Function | |
Supply Voltage | 5V | |
Base Part Number | ADA4899 | |
Pin Count | 8 | |
Number of Channels | 1Channel | |
Operating Supply Current | 16.2mA | |
Nominal Supply Current | 16.2mA | |
Output Current | 30mA | |
Quiescent Current | 14.7mA | |
Slew Rate | 310V/μs |
Product Attribute | Attribute Value | |
---|---|---|
Amplifier Type | Voltage Feedback | |
Common Mode Rejection Ratio | 130 dB | |
Current - Input Bias | 6μA | |
Voltage - Supply, Single/Dual (±) | 4.5V~12V ±2.25V~6V | |
Output Current per Channel | 200mA | |
Input Offset Voltage (Vos) | 230μV | |
Bandwidth | 600MHz | |
Gain Bandwidth Product | 280MHz | |
Neg Supply Voltage-Nom (Vsup) | -5V | |
Voltage Gain | 80dB | |
Power Supply Rejection Ratio (PSRR) | 93dB | |
Low-Offset | YES | |
Voltage - Input Offset | 35μV | |
Gain | 1 dB | |
Settling Time | 50 ns | |
Low-Bias | NO | |
Micropower | NO | |
-3db Bandwidth | 600MHz | |
Programmable Power | NO | |
Dual Supply Voltage | 5V | |
Input Capacitance | 4.4pF | |
Input Offset Current-Max (IIO) | 0.7μA | |
Height | 1.65mm | |
Length | 4.9mm | |
Width | 3.9mm | |
REACH SVHC | No SVHC | |
Radiation Hardening | No | |
RoHS Status | ROHS3 Compliant | |
Lead Free | Contains Lead |
